NOVELTY - The preparation method of copper-zinc-tin-selenium fused graphene oxide photocatalytic adsorption material involves loading copper-zinc-tin-selenium composition on graphene oxide. USE - Preparation of copper-zinc-tin-selenium fused graphene oxide photocatalytic adsorption material used for photocatalytic degradation of organic dye in wastewater (claimed). ADVANTAGE - The method enables the preparation of copper-zinc-tin-selenium fused graphene oxide photocatalytic adsorption material with high light absorption coefficient, excellent electron transport performance, organic pollutant adsorption property, and photocatalytic performance. DETAILED DESCRIPTION - The preparation method of copper-zinc-tin-selenium-graphene oxide photocatalytic adsorption material involves loading copper-zinc-tin-selenium composition which is represented by formula: Cu2ZnSnSe4 on graphene oxide.
